wise up
英 [waɪz ʌp]
美 [waɪz ʌp]
意识到; 觉察到; 开始对…采取适当行动
柯林斯词典
- PHRASAL VERB 意识到;觉察到;开始对…采取适当行动
If someonewises upto a situation or state of affairs, they become aware of it and take appropriate action.- Some insurers have wised up to the fact that their clients were getting very cheap insurance...
一些保险公司已经意识到其客户所得到的保险金非常少。 - It's time to wise up and tell those around you that enough is enough.
现在该觉醒了,告诉你周围的人要适可而止。
